From 1e6f7927557cc0af5aead16b0579a6828d94b857 Mon Sep 17 00:00:00 2001 From: Jonathan Teh Date: Tue, 22 Feb 2022 23:28:44 +0000 Subject: dsp: Fix assignment of Op11Xr Fix regression introduced in snes9x-1.40. --- source/dsp1.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/source/dsp1.c b/source/dsp1.c index f8a0713..fc7720e 100644 --- a/source/dsp1.c +++ b/source/dsp1.c @@ -352,7 +352,7 @@ void DSP1SetByte(uint8_t byte, uint16_t address) Op11m = (int16_t)(DSP1.parameters [0] | (DSP1.parameters[1] << 8)); Op11Zr = (int16_t)(DSP1.parameters [2] | (DSP1.parameters[3] << 8)); Op11Yr = (int16_t)(DSP1.parameters [4] | (DSP1.parameters[5] << 8)); - Op11Xr = (int16_t)(DSP1.parameters [7] | (DSP1.parameters[7] << 8)); + Op11Xr = (int16_t)(DSP1.parameters [6] | (DSP1.parameters[7] << 8)); DSPOp11(); break; case 0x25: -- cgit v1.2.3